Factors Influencing Cost
Slate roof construction in Lexington, MA, involves installing durable, natural slate tiles that provide a classic and long-lasting roofing solution.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ning for this specialized project.
- Materials: Natural slate tiles known for their durability and aesthetic appeal, often sourced from regional or imported suppliers.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s to full roof replacements, typically covering standard residential roof areas in Lexington.
- Labor Complexity: Installation requires skilled craftsmanship due to the weight and precise fitting of slate tiles, impacting labor time and costs.
- Permitting: Local building permits are generally required, with inspections to ensure code compliance for slate roofing systems.
- Additional Considerations: Options may include custom patterns, decorative features, or underlayment upgrades, which can influence overall project scope and costs.
